McKesson Corporation Congressional Trading

According to U.S. congressional financial disclosures filed under the STOCK Act, members of Congress have reported 195 trades in McKesson Corporation (NYSE: MCK) since 2013, across 38 members, worth an estimated $2.1M in disclosed volume (the midpoint of the dollar ranges members report, not exact amounts). 111 buys against 84 sells, a modestly buy-led skew, with Democratic members responsible for 56% of the trades and Republican members 44%. The most recent disclosure shown was filed August 2026, and Rohit Khanna has filed the most MCK transactions among those shown, with 11. Other recent filers include Rick Larsen, Jonathan Jackson, and Elizabeth Fletcher. One notable disclosed move was a purchase by Valerie Hoyle on September 10, 2025, up 28.5% since. These figures are drawn from public House and Senate periodic transaction reports and reflect what members were required to disclose, not the current market value of any position. Can members of Congress legally trade McKesson (MCK) stock?

Yes. Members of Congress are permitted to trade individual stocks, including McKesson (MCK), but the STOCK Act of 2012 requires them to publicly disclose each transaction within 45 days. Quantellect tracks those disclosures; it does not imply any trade was improper.

Are congressional McKesson (MCK) trades public?

Yes. Every congressional trade in McKesson (MCK) on this page comes from mandatory public STOCK Act disclosure filings, which are filed with a delay and may be revised.
